RE: Federal Parent Locator Service (FPLS) Safeguarding Certification & Federal Collections and Enforcement (FCE) Programs Annual Certification Letters
Dear Colleague:
Annually, each state is required to complete and submit to the Federal Office of Child Support Enforcement (OCSE) two signed certification documents.
The FPLS Annual Safeguarding document certifies that your state is compliant with safeguarding and security requirements relating to locate information received from the FPLS and that information is used only for the intended purposes.
The FCE Annual Certification Letter document certifies that the information submitted by your state meets the legal requirements for federal offset, passport denial, multistate financial institution data match and federal insurance match. It also provides information as to your state’s preferences regarding mailing of pre-offset notices, holding periods, and contact information.
Both certifications require the signature of your state’s IV-D Director or designee. Copies of both documents are enclosed for your use. Please fax a signed copy of each certification document by September 17, 2010, and mail the originals for our records to:
